Wie funktioniert der Zugriff auf den internen Speicher in Termux?

Melden
  1. Einführung in Termux und den internen Speicher
  2. Zugriffsrechte und Sicherheitsaspekte
  3. Freigabe des internen Speichers in Termux
  4. Speicherort und Dateipfade in Termux
  5. Besondere Hinweise zur Nutzung
  6. Fazit

Einführung in Termux und den internen Speicher

Termux ist eine leistungsfähige Terminal-Emulator-App für Android, die eine Linux-Umgebung auf mobilen Geräten bereitstellt. Eine wichtige Funktion für viele Nutzer ist die Möglichkeit, auf den internen Speicher des Geräts zuzugreifen. Der interne Speicher bezeichnet hierbei den Bereich, in dem Dateien, Dokumente, Medien und sonstige Daten des Android-Systems und der Apps abgelegt werden. Im Gegensatz zur SD-Karte ist der interne Speicher fest im Gerät verbaut.

Zugriffsrechte und Sicherheitsaspekte

Da Android aus Sicherheitsgründen den Zugriff von Apps auf den internen Speicher einschränkt, ist auch für Termux nicht von vornherein freier Zugriff möglich. Um auf den internen Speicher zugreifen zu können, muss Termux die entsprechenden Berechtigungen erhalten. Dazu gehört insbesondere die Berechtigung zum Lesen und Schreiben auf dem Speicher. Ohne diese Zugriffsrechte kann Termux keine Dateien außerhalb seines eigenen App-Ordners bearbeiten oder lesen.

Freigabe des internen Speichers in Termux

Um den Zugriff auf den internen Speicher zu ermöglichen, bietet Termux den Befehl termux-setup-storage an. Mit Ausführung dieses Befehls fordert die App die notwendigen Systemberechtigungen an. Nach Bestätigung durch den Nutzer wird ein neuer Verzeichnis-Link namens storage im Home-Verzeichnis von Termux erstellt. Innerhalb dieses Verzeichnisses befinden sich Unterordner wie shared, die auf den gemeinsamen Speicher zugreifen, sowie spezifische Ordner, die auf verschiedene Speicherbereiche des Geräts verweisen.

Speicherort und Dateipfade in Termux

Nach der Einrichtung über termux-setup-storage sind die Dateien des internen Speichers im Pfad ~/storage/shared erreichbar. Das entspricht etwa dem Pfad /sdcard oder /storage/emulated/0 auf Android. Auf diese Weise können Benutzer mit normalen Linux-Befehlen wie ls, cd, cp oder mv auf ihre Dateien zugreifen, sie bearbeiten, kopieren oder verschieben.

Besondere Hinweise zur Nutzung

Es ist wichtig zu beachten, dass nicht alle Bereiche des internen Speichers uneingeschränkt zugänglich sind. Einige System- oder App-spezifische Ordner sind weiterhin geschützt. Außerdem kann der Zugriff durch neuere Android-Versionen zusätzlich eingeschränkt sein, was auf die erhöhte Sicherheitsarchitektur zurückzuführen ist. Deshalb empfiehlt es sich, die aktuellste Version von Termux und die entsprechenden Berechtigungen zu nutzen.

Fazit

Der Zugriff auf den internen Speicher in Termux ist mit wenigen Schritten möglich und erweitert die Möglichkeiten, die eigene Android-Umgebung im Terminal zu verwalten. Über den Befehl termux-setup-storage werden erforderliche Berechtigungen erteilt, und ein direkter Zugriff auf die üblichen Speicherorte wird eingerichtet. Dies ermöglicht eine komfortable und flexible Nutzung unter Beachtung der Sicherheitsrestriktionen von Android.

0

Kommentare